I have just tried NL10 for the first time, kept sayin I would move up a stake when my balance reached 500euro but I just wouldnt take the risk of the next level.

I thought I would give it a try as the last mission on Unibet this month requires you to complete 2 minor missions for 250 points for an NL10 ticket(completing minors at higher stakes get you bigger tickets).

It wasnt as bad as i thought even though there were better players, there were a lot less maniacs than I normally see at NL4.

I managed to play  200ish flops and am down 2.26 euros which I am quite happy with as I thought I would lose quite a bit more at my first attempt at NL10.

I think having a comfortable balance for the stake I am trying helps take away some pressure and I have been very nitty with my BRM and some people have said to me I should have moved up earlier, if I lose 5 buyins I will go back down to NL4 and rebuild and try again.

Hoping I can stay up a level, its took me just over a year to get here after some good wins and then bad decisions putting my balance back to zero. I have managed to rebuild from zero in April with help from a Unibet promo and the competion on here.

Lets see if I can avoid the bad decisions and build the roll a bit more.

Hello Jonny. I'm a cash game player myself and it's good to see you are doing well and most importantly practising good BRM! I agree you should probably have moved up a bit earlier. I've always stuck to 30 bi's at the microstakes and think that it is more than enough at these stakes. I've never come close to blowing my roll in a few years playing cash. As i move up in stakes i'm aware i'll need to shift the number upwards though.

As you know, 4nl is super soft on Unibet and if you have been crushing that you will notice the difference at 10nl but ultimately should still do well.
